Good morning. Speaking of the resurrection of Jesus: who is at the right hand of God, having gone into heaven, after angels and authorities and powers had been subjected to Him. Since Christ has suffered in the flesh arm yourselves also with the same purpose, because he who has suffered in the flesh has ceased from sin. Now the margin says that it means suffered death in the flesh. Of course if you have died, then you certainly are not going to keep on sinning. The result is that we are to live the rest of the time in the flesh no longer for the lusts of men, but for the will of God. For the time already past is sufficient for you to have carried out the desire of the Gentiles (it then lists a bunch of bad things). We should be done with all of those bad things. They are surprised that you do not run with them into the same excess of dissipation, and they malign you. They think that you should be enjoying the same bad things that they enjoy. And so in order that they don't feel badly about the things they do, they say bad things about you. They shall give account to Him who is ready to judge the living and the dead. The Gospel has for this purpose been preached even to those who are dead, that though they are judged in the flesh as men, they may live in the Spirit according to the will of God.
